Transaction 108c4806a24fda3580d70c91b30bcda86085eefdef7f67f0ecc9d7689ced3503

3 Input
1 Outputs
  • 108c4806a24fda3580d70c91b30bcda86085eefdef7f67f0ecc9d7689ced3503:0
  • value  1087651
    address  1LFnATC5ddzdJ5PV4nRsEs68hYC7Kkg3sy